Bus Options from Tralee to Dublin
Type | company | departure station | arrival station | departure time | arrival time | Frequency | Duration | Price Range | layover city |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Direct | Dublin Coach | Tralee Station, Tralee | Bachelors Walk, Dublin | 08:00, 09:00, 10:00, 11:00, 12:00, 13:00, 14:00, 15:00, 16:00, 17:00, 18:00, 19:00 | 12:30, 13:30, 14:30, 15:30, 16:30, 17:30, 18:30, 19:30, 20:30, 21:30, 22:30, 23:30 | Hourly | 4h 30m | € 23-33 | |
Connecting | Bus Éireann | Tralee Station, Tralee | Busáras, Dublin | 07:10, 08:10, 09:10 | 12:15, 13:15, 14:15 | Three times daily | 5h 10m | € 25-35 | Limerick |
Comparison of Bus Operators from Tralee to Dublin
Comparing bus operators servicing the Tralee to Dublin route is essential for travelers seeking comfort, convenience, and value for their money. Factors such as pricing, amenities, baggage policies, and accessibility can significantly impact your travel experience.
Criteria | Dublin Coach | Bus Éireann |
---|---|---|
Price Range | € 23 - € 33 | € 25 - € 35 |
pricing policies | ||
refund policy | Full refund available if canceled 24 hours before departure. | Refund requests accepted up to 30 minutes before departure, service charges may apply. |
Ticket Changes | Tickets can be changed without fee up to 1 hour before departure. | Free changes permitted up to 1 hour prior to travel. |
discounts | 10% discount available for students and seniors. | Family tickets and group rates available. |
amenities | Free Wi-Fi, Power outlets, Comfortable seating, Onboard restroom | Wi-Fi available, Reclining seats, Reading lights, Onboard snacks for purchase |
baggage allowance | ||
free allowance | 1 piece of hand luggage and 1 checked bag (up to 20 kg) free of charge. | 2 pieces of luggage up to 20 kg each are included. |
Additional Fees | €5 fee for any additional checked bag. | €10 fee for extra luggage. |
accessibility | Wheelchair accessible with designated seating and assistance available. | Fully accessible buses with ramps and priority seating. |
Dublin Coach offers competitive pricing and a range of amenities, perfect for tech-savvy travelers looking for comfort and free Wi-Fi. Bus Éireann provides slightly higher fare options but comes with additional baggage allowance and family-friendly pricing. Travelers should choose based on their specific needs for amenities, budget, and baggage requirements.

Travel Tips
⛰ Enjoy Scenic Views
The bus route from Tralee to Dublin offers stunning views of the Irish countryside. Sit on the right side of the bus to catch glimpses of the beautiful Slieve Mish Mountains and the lush landscapes of County Kerry.
📍 Plan for Comfort
Bring a travel pillow and a light blanket for added comfort during the longer stretches of the journey. Some buses provide charging ports, so bring your devices fully charged to enjoy the ride.
🚍 Explore Stops Along the Way
Consider stopping at towns like Killarney or Castleisland for a quick tour. Killarney National Park is a must-see if you have time, with its breathtaking scenery and historic sites.
🎭 Advance Booking is Key
Book your tickets in advance, especially during peak traveling seasons or local festivals. Events like the Tralee International Circus Festival can influence bus availability.
